conferences | speakers | series

Tracking Firefox performance via Telemetry

home

Tracking Firefox performance via Telemetry
FOSDEM 2012

Traditionally Mozilla measured Firefox performance with a set of performance tests called Talos. For features not covered by Talos developers benchmarked individual features themselves. However, it turns it is extremely difficult to design a representative testsuite. Reproducing performance problems is often harder than fixing them. Telemetry is a way to measure Firefox performance & usage in the field. It allows developers to insert lightweight probes and then use them to track how Firefox behaves in the wild. We have been using Telemetry to improve Firefox since version 7. We will soon roll out Telemetry to addon developers so they can benefit from the same infrastructure. This talk will cover how Telemetry is used and the kinds of problems it helped us fix so far.

Speakers: Taras Glek